Chinese Taipei Ice Hockey League

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

The Chinese Taipei Ice Hockey League ( CIHL for short ; Chinese  中華 冰球 聯盟 ) is the highest ice hockey league in the Republic of China (Taiwan) .

history

The Chinese Taipei Ice Hockey League was first played in 2004. The league is divided into two different divisions. While the more powerful teams compete in the International Division, in which mainly foreigners from countries with a long ice hockey tradition play, in the Open Division predominantly local players are used.
